		<title>Cast steel bellows seal globe</title>
		<link>https://www.vibtis.al/products/cast-steel-bellows-seal-globe/</link>
		
		<dc:creator><![CDATA[arber]]></dc:creator>
		<pubDate>Sun, 29 Jul 2018 12:26:31 +0000</pubDate>
				<guid isPermaLink="false">http://localhost:8888/vibtis/?post_type=product&#038;p=3382</guid>

					<description><![CDATA[Features and benefits
● Long cycle life bellows (3000 cycles) in Gr. 321 (stainless), Inconel for special applications, or Hastelloy C for chlorine service.
● Bolted body-bonnet joints for fast serviceability. Fully enclosed spiral wound Gr. 316 (stainless) graphite gaskets.
● Non-rotating stem prevents torsion of bellows.
● Two-secondary stem seals: a) Back seat in open position; b) Graphite packing.
● Bellows monitoring port (optional): A plug can be connected to the space above the bellows to monitor performance.
● Seat and disc hardfaced with CoCr alloy, ground and lapped. ]]></description>

		<title>Cast steel bellows seal gate</title>
		<link>https://www.vibtis.al/products/cast-steel-bellows-seal-gate/</link>
		
		<dc:creator><![CDATA[arber]]></dc:creator>
		<pubDate>Sun, 29 Jul 2018 12:25:46 +0000</pubDate>
				<guid isPermaLink="false">http://localhost:8888/vibtis/?post_type=product&#038;p=3380</guid>

					<description><![CDATA[Features and benefits
● Long cycle life bellows (2000 cycles) in Gr. 321 (stainless), Inconel for special applications, (may be replaced with Monel trim to resist corrosion or Hastelloy C for chlorine service).
● Improved body-bonnet joint: Graphite reinforced with SS foil gasket for Class 150 valves. Fully-encased, spiral wound graphite-filled Gr. 316 (stainless) gasket for Classes 300-600.
● Bolted body-bonnet for fast serviceability. Hermetically-sealed bonnets available for Classes 300 and 600.
● Two or three section bellows assembly.
● Non-rotating stemprevents torsion of bellows.
● Two secondary stem seals: a) Backseat in open position; b) Graphite packing.
● Welded-in seat hardfaced with CoCr alloy.
● Wedge hardfaced with CoCr alloy for long life.
● Seating faces hardfaced with CoCr alloy, ground and lapped.]]></description>

		<title>HF Acid valves</title>
		<link>https://www.vibtis.al/products/hf-acid-valves/</link>
		
		<dc:creator><![CDATA[arber]]></dc:creator>
		<pubDate>Sun, 29 Jul 2018 12:24:56 +0000</pubDate>
				<guid isPermaLink="false">http://localhost:8888/vibtis/?post_type=product&#038;p=3378</guid>

					<description><![CDATA[Features and benefits
Fugitive emissions are a critical factor in the performance of any HF Acid valve and at Velan, we have been committed to reducing emissions beyond the industry standards, and providing the highest quality products to our customers for over 50 years. Velan offers a comprehensive line of Phillips approved and UOP listed API 600 gate, globe and check HF acid valves with several benefits.

● Nickel plated overlay on backseat in stem hole to combat severe alkylation conditions.
● HF acid detecting paint to ensure valve integrity.
● Stem - made from solid age hardened K-Monel 500 for increased strength and corrosion resistance.
● Casting design X-ray “RT“ quality castings as per B16.34 acceptance standards.
● Bonnet Joint - accurately machined for better service life.
● Seal welded seats in Monel: Monel seats are welded-in for ensuring zero leakage behind and around the seat and then ground and lapped after welding using state of the art technology to prevent in-service corrosion.
● Body/Bonnet wall thickness to API 600.
● Velan’s low-fugitive emissions guarantee: Based on extensive laboratory testing and field experience. ]]></description>

		<title>Cryogenic swing check valves</title>
		<link>https://www.vibtis.al/products/cryogenic-swing-check-valves/</link>
		
		<dc:creator><![CDATA[arber]]></dc:creator>
		<pubDate>Sun, 29 Jul 2018 12:24:11 +0000</pubDate>
				<guid isPermaLink="false">http://localhost:8888/vibtis/?post_type=product&#038;p=3376</guid>

					<description><![CDATA[Features and benefits
All basic design features of Velan cast steel swing check valves are adapted to special service conditions at cryogenic temperatures.

ADDITIONAL DESIGN FEATURES:
● Extended bonnets with sufficient gas column length, usually specified by customer, are supplied for all valves to keep stem packing at sufficient distance away from the cold fluid to remain functional.
● Flexible wedges with Stellite seating faces for cryogenic service.
● Neoflon inserts are available for swing check discs.
● Cleaning: All cryogenic valves are thoroughly degreased and cleaned and pipe ends are sealed to prevent contamination.]]></description>

		<title>Swing check valves</title>
		<link>https://www.vibtis.al/products/swing-check-valves/</link>
		
		<dc:creator><![CDATA[arber]]></dc:creator>
		<pubDate>Sun, 29 Jul 2018 12:20:44 +0000</pubDate>
				<guid isPermaLink="false">http://localhost:8888/vibtis/?post_type=product&#038;p=3366</guid>

					<description><![CDATA[Features and benefits
● Body and cover: Precision machined castings.
Exclusive: Disc shaft does not penetrate body.
● Body and cover joint: Accurately machined, 
fully-enclosed gasket.
● Disc: Robust one-piece construction to withstand the severe shock of check valve service. Hardfaced with 13Cr, CoCr alloy, SS 316, or Monel, ground and lapped to a mirror finish. Sizes NPS 2–6 (DN 50–150) may have solid CA 15 (13Cr) disc. SS 316 disc with CoCr alloy facing also available.
● Disc assembly: Non-rotating disc is fastened securely to disc hanger with a lock nut and cotter pin. Disc hanger is supported on a sturdy disc carrier hinge pin of excellent bearing qualities. All parts are accessible from top for easy servicing.
● Flanges:
ASME Classes 150–300: 1⁄16” raised face.
ASME Classes 600–1500: 1⁄4” raised face.
Finish 125–250 AARH for all valves. ]]></description>

		<title>Globe valves</title>
		<link>https://www.vibtis.al/products/globe-valves/</link>
		
		<dc:creator><![CDATA[arber]]></dc:creator>
		<pubDate>Sun, 29 Jul 2018 12:20:00 +0000</pubDate>
				<guid isPermaLink="false">http://localhost:8888/vibtis/?post_type=product&#038;p=3364</guid>

					<description><![CDATA[Features and benefits
● Non-rotating stem with precision Acme threads and burnished finish. Valve suitable for horizontal installation. 
● Universal trim. 13Cr stem, 13Cr faced disc, and CoCr alloy faced seats API Trim 8 suitable for service up to 850°F (454°C).
● Seat face CoCr alloy hardfaced, ground, and lapped to a mirror finish. Conical seat machined to 8 RMS.
● Tapered disc.
Body guided disc accurately mates the hardfaced surface of the disc with the surface of the seat, hardfaced with 13Cr, CoCr alloy, SS 316, or Monel, ground and lapped with seat.
● Disc in SS 316 hardfaced with CoCr alloy also available. NPS 2–6 (DN 50–150) valves may have solid CA15 (13Cr) discs. 
● Body and bonnet. Castings are precision machined. One-piece bonnet for better alignment, fewer parts. 
● Stuffing box finish to 63 RMS or better.
● Body and bonnet joint accurately machined. Fully enclosed gasket.
● Gland has two-piece construction for easy alignment.
● Rotating stem nut. Austenitic ductile iron Gr. D-2C, renewable in-line.
● Torque arm reduces wear on packing rings and enables better sealing and reduces torque.
● Impactor handwheels.
Globe and stop check valves require higher closing torques than gate valves with the same seat diameter and pressure class. The most economical mechanism for tight shutoff is the impactor handwheel. Two lugs cast under the wheel strike simultaneous blows and give 3–10 times the closing force of standard handwheels. Impactor handwheels are supplied at manufacturer’s option unless specified by customer.
● Flanges:
ASME Classes 150–300: 1⁄16” raised face.
ASME Classes 600–1500: 1⁄4” raised face.
Finish 125–250 AARH for all valves.]]></description>

		<title>Gate valves (API 600)</title>
		<link>https://www.vibtis.al/products/gate-valves-api-600/</link>
		
		<dc:creator><![CDATA[arber]]></dc:creator>
		<pubDate>Sun, 29 Jul 2018 12:19:13 +0000</pubDate>
				<guid isPermaLink="false">http://localhost:8888/vibtis/?post_type=product&#038;p=3362</guid>

					<description><![CDATA[Features and benefits
● Universal trim: 13Cr stem, wedge in CA 15 or 13Cr faced, and CoCr alloy seat API Trim 8 suitable for applications up to 850°F (454°C).
● Seat face CoCr alloy hardfaced, ground and lapped to a mirror finish.
● Flexible wedge with low center stem wedge contact, in solid CA15 (13Cr)or hardfaced with 13Cr, SS 316, Monel or CoCr alloy. Wedge is ground and lapped to a mirror finish and tightly guided to prevent dragging and seat damage. A CoCr alloy hardfaced CF8M wedge is also available.
● Non-rotating stem with precision Acme threads and burnished finish. Double Acme for faster operation.
● Body and bonnet joint accurately machined. 
● Body and bonnet castings are precision machined. One-piece bonnet up to NPS 12 (DN 300) for better alignment and fewer parts. 
● Flanges: ASME Classes 150–300: 1⁄16” raised face. 
ASME Classes 600–1500: 1⁄4” raised face. 
Finish 125–250 AARH for all valves. 
● Rotating stem nut is Austenitic ductile iron Gr. D-2C renewable in line (as shown). Thrust bearings are supplied as follows: ASME Classes 150–300: NPS 10–12 (DN 250–300), 1 bearing (top), 
NPS 16 (DN 400) and up, two bearings, 
ASME Classes 600–1500: NPS 6 (DN 150) and up.]]></description>
